Hallo Forengemeinde,
bevor ich mit irgend etwas anfangen werde möchte ich mich bei uch für die vielen hilfreichen Tipps und Antworten bedanken, die dazu begetragen haben, dass mein Asterisk läuft.
Der Asterisk mit einer Sirrix-PCI4S0 hängt am internen S0 einer Alcatel 4400 - Telefonanlage und soll hauptsächlich als Voicemail-Maschine eingesetzt werden. Testweise sind auch ein paar SIP-Teilnehmer eingereichtet um innerhalb des Hausnetztes telefonieren zu können.
Die Voicemail mit allen Funktionen und auch die SIP-Gespräche laufen problemfrei.
Aber nun das Problem - der Asterisk läuft nicht stabil.
Nach unterschiedlich langer Laufzeit (im Schnitt etwa zwei Stunden) bekomme ich einen der beiden folgenen Fehler in den Logfiles "/var/log/messages" und "/var/log/warn":Danach läuft alles noch im Schnitt eine Stunde weiter und der Fehler tritt erneut auf, woraufhin der Asterisk nicht mehr funktionstüchtig ist. Am Telefon bekomme ich die Meldung "Link ausser Betrieb" beim Versuch die Voicemail zu anzurufen.
- sirrix ipac (0): D-channel received empty frame, discarding frame
- sirrix ipac (0): D-channel receive data overflow, discarding frame (RSTAD=0xc)
Ein Neustart des Asterisk und auch das entladen und neuladen der Sirrix-Treiber bringt keine Abhilfe. Es hilft nur ein Server-Neustart, was im produktiven Betrieb natürlich absolut unpraktikabel ist.
Das >> hier << beschrieben D-Channel-Dump bricht genau an der Stelle ab, wenn ein leeres Frame oder der data overflow reinkommt.
Hat jemand schon mal ein ähnliches Problem gehabt?
Oder eine Idee warum diese D-Channel Fehler auftauchen?
Kann es sein, dass der Fehler von der Telefonanlage kommt?
Oder hab ich einen Fehler in meiner sirrix.conf, die diesen Fehler verursacht?
sirrix.conf
Ich bin für jede Hilfe extrem dankbar.Code:[Global] internationalprefix = 00 nationalprefix = 0 ;Eingehende Anrufe [Incomming] ports = 0000 ; 1. Karte, 1. Port mode = TE ; TE Mode da die Karte an einem S0 Bus ptp = yes ; Anlagenanschluss master = yes ; Port arbeitet als Master number = + ; Angerufene Nummer extension = + ; Anzurufenden Extension callerid = <+> ; CallerID von eingehenden Anrufen show_cidname = yes ; Anrufernamen zeigen country = de ; Land language = de ; Sprache ;Abgehende Anrufe [Outgoing] ports = 0000 ; 1. Karte, 1. Port mode = TE ; TE Mode da die Karte an einem S0 Bus ptp = yes ; Anlagenanschluss master = yes ; Port arbeitet als Master number = + ; Angerufene Nummer extension = ; Anzurufenden Extension callerid = + ; CallerID von ausgehenden Anrufen cfnotify = no cfu = no cfnr = no cfb = no aocd = no colp = no redir = no notify = yes echocancel = yes providetones = yes
Mfg Szony


Zitieren
bei größeren Installationen natürlich eine große Hilfe!